AmeriFlux US-Sne Sherman Island Restored Wetland
Abstract
This is the AmeriFlux version of the carbon flux data for the site US-Sne Sherman Island Restored Wetland. Site Description - A new restored wetland on the old Sherman Pasture site. The new tower is about 67m northwest (300deg) of the old tower site (US-Snd). On Jan 30, 2020 a temporary tower was set up in the western portion of Sherman Wetland to capture the more vegetated areas and compare with the main tower.
